Geologists and volunteers for the first time visited the Barkhut well - a cave 60 meters deep, which, according to local beliefs, is the abode of evil spirits.

In the east of Yemen, in Hadhramaut, there is a large limestone cave, which in Islamic eschatology is identified with Barhut - a well associated with the underworld and inhabited by the souls of infidels. Locals believe that jinn live inside a natural phenomenon, and the well itself is the gates of Hell. Legends of evil spirits are reinforced by stories of hideous fumes rising to the surface. Many local residents go around the well a mile away and prefer not to mention it in conversations, believing that this can bring misfortune.

The other day, a team of geologists from the German University of Technology in Oman and cavers from Research Group in Oman caves made the descent into the well, reports of The of Sun. They were probably the first people to visit there. At a depth of 50-60 meters, the researchers found snakes, dead birds and cave pearls - balls of calcite formed by dripping water. And no sign of the supernatural. Now the finds raised to the surface are being studied in the laboratory.

The origin of the well remains a mystery to scientists. Some speculate that this is a supervolcano that will wake up sooner or later, but there is no evidence for this theory. Others hypothesize that this is one of the "heaving mounds" of pingo - mounds with an ice core, which have recently appeared in Yamal, Taimyr and in the Krasnoyarsk Territory.
